A New Source of Mutilating Hand Injuries: The Side-by-Side Utility Terrain Vehicle.

Shaun D Mendenhall1,2, Emily M Graham3,2, Stanley Memmott3

  • 1From the Division of Plastic Surgery.

Plastic and Reconstructive Surgery
|March 21, 2023
PubMed
Summary

Side-by-side utility terrain vehicle (UTV) riders experience significantly more severe hand injuries, including amputations, compared to all-terrain vehicle (ATV) riders. UTV accidents also lead to longer hospital stays and more operations, highlighting increased risks.

Background:

  • Mutilating hand injuries from all-terrain vehicles (ATVs) and utility terrain vehicles (UTVs) are on the rise.
  • Understanding injury patterns and outcomes associated with ATV and UTV accidents is crucial for improving patient care.

Purpose of the Study:

  • To compare upper extremity (UE) injury patterns, severity, and treatment outcomes between ATV and UTV accidents.
  • To identify specific risks associated with UTV use in relation to hand and UE injuries.

Main Methods:

  • Retrospective analysis of 154 cases involving ATV and UTV accidents.
  • Comparison of injury types, fracture severity (open vs. closed), amputation rates, hospital/ICU length of stay, and number of operations.
  • Statistical analysis using Fisher exact tests, MANOVA, ANOVA, and multiple linear regressions.

Main Results:

  • UTV riders had significantly more hand/finger injuries, open fractures, mutilating hand injuries, and amputations compared to ATV riders.
  • UTV group experienced longer hospital stays (2.5 days), ICU stays (0.91 days), and required more operations (1.3) than the ATV group.
  • Vehicle type was the sole significant predictor for hospital days, ICU days, and UE operations.

Conclusions:

  • Hand surgeons play a vital role in raising public awareness about the risks associated with off-road vehicles.
  • Collaboration with manufacturers and healthcare providers is essential to promote rider safety and improve patient outcomes.
